Title:
METHOD FOR MANUFACTURING STACKED-TYPE DIELECTRIC ACTUATOR
Document Type and Number:
WIPO Patent Application WO/2019/198650
Kind Code:
A1
Abstract:
A stacked-type dielectric actuator includes a stacked body (10a) obtained by stacking a plurality of unit layers (11). Each unit layer (11) is provided with a dielectric layer (12) made from a dielectric elastomer, and an electrode layer (13) made from an electrically conductive elastomer and provided on one surface of the dielectric layer. The method for manufacturing the stacked-type dielectric actuator is provided with: a first step of forming a film (12a) made from the dielectric elastomer; a second step of curing the film (12a) made from the dielectric elastomer to form the dielectric layer (12); a third step of forming a film (13a) made from the electrically conductive elastomer on the dielectric layer (12); and a fourth step of curing the film (13a) made from the electrically conductive elastomer to form the electrode layer (13). In this manufacturing method, the stacked bodies (10a) are formed on each of a plurality of bases (30) by repeatedly performing the first step to the fourth step sequentially a plurality of times each, on the plurality of bases (30), while the plurality of bases (30), arranged side by side in a conveying direction (A) on a circulating conveying route, are each being circulated.
